Target Information

Chicken glyceraldehyde-3-phosphate dehydrogenase (GAPDH) is a multifaceted enzyme primarily recognized for its role in glycolysis, the metabolic pathway that generates energy for cells. In addition to its catalytic function in glucose breakdown, GAPDH has been implicated in a variety of non-glycolytic activities, such as protein synthesis, nuclear tRNA export, microtubule assembly, membrane fusion, and apoptosis .Moreover, GAPDH has been shown to participate in the immune response, modulating the functions of chicken dendritic cells to boost Th1 type immune response and stimulate autologous CD4+ T cells differentiation in-vitro. This protein's diverse roles underscore its importance in maintaining cellular homeostasis and adapting to different physiological and pathological conditions in chickens.

Shipping and Storage

This product is shipped with dry ice. It is recommended to aliquot as needed and store at -80°C upon receipt. Reconstituted protein solution can be stored at 4°C for 1 week, at < -80°C for 12 months. Avoid repeated freezing and thawing.
